General dentistry is the foundation everything else is built on. At its core, it includes routine exams and digital X-rays, professional cleanings to remove plaque and tartar buildup, cavity detection and tooth-colored fillings, and screenings for gum disease and oral cancer. Sealants and fluoride treatments round out the preventive side for both kids and adults.
Most dental problems don't announce themselves early. A cavity can sit quietly for months before it causes pain, and gum disease often progresses without obvious symptoms until it has already affected the bone supporting your teeth. Routine visits every six months let your dentist catch these issues while they're still small and inexpensive to treat, rather than after they've turned into a root canal or worse.
A typical visit starts with a quick review of your health history and any concerns you want to flag, followed by a full exam and X-rays if you're due for them. From there, a hygienist will clean your teeth, and the dentist will walk you through anything they noticed, with a plan for next steps if needed. Most checkups wrap up in under an hour.
Every six months is the standard recommendation for most patients, though some with a history of gum disease or frequent cavities may be asked to come in more often.
